Are There Techniques To Reduce The Visibility Of Scarring From An Ear Lobe Repair?
Dr Vishal Purohit, plastic surgeon, has some good news for those who have had an ear lobe repair and are looking to reduce the visibility of scarring. According to Dr Purohit, there are a few techniques that can be used to reduce the visibility of scarring from an ear lobe repair.
The first technique is to use a topical silicone gel. This gel is applied to the scarred area and helps to reduce the appearance of the scar. It also helps to soften the scar, making it less noticeable.
The second technique is to use laser treatments. Laser treatments can help to reduce the appearance of the scar by breaking down the scar tissue and stimulating collagen production. This can help to reduce the visibility of the scar.
The third technique is to use a steroid injection. This is injected into the scarred area and helps to reduce the inflammation and redness associated with the scar.
Finally, Dr Purohit recommends using a scar cream. This cream helps to reduce the appearance of the scar by keeping the skin moisturized and helping to reduce the redness and inflammation associated with the scar.
So, if you’re looking to reduce the visibility of scarring from an ear lobe repair, there are a few techniques that can help. Talk to your doctor to find out which technique is right for you.
Does The Type Of Ear Lobe Repair Affect When It Is Ok To Start Wearing Jewelry Again?
Dr Vishal Purohit, a renowned plastic surgeon, has the answer to the question on everyone’s mind: does the type of ear lobe repair affect when it is OK to start wearing jewelry again?
The answer is a resounding yes! According to Dr Purohit, the type of ear lobe repair does affect when it is OK to start wearing jewelry again. Depending on the type of repair, it can take anywhere from a few weeks to several months before it is safe to start wearing jewelry again.
For example, if the ear lobe repair is done with sutures, it is important to wait until the sutures have been removed and the wound has healed completely before wearing jewelry. This can take anywhere from two to four weeks.
On the other hand, if the ear lobe repair is done with a skin graft, it can take several months before it is safe to start wearing jewelry again. This is because the skin graft needs time to heal and become strong enough to support the weight of the jewelry.
No matter what type of ear lobe repair is done, it is important to wait until the wound has healed completely before wearing jewelry. This will help ensure that the ear lobe is strong enough to support the weight of the jewelry and prevent any further damage.

Can One Expect The Same Softness In Healed Skin As With Normal Undamaged Skin?
Dr Vishal Purohit, plastic surgeon, has a simple answer to the question of whether one can expect the same softness in healed skin as with normal undamaged skin: it depends.
“It depends on the type of skin damage and the treatment used to heal it,” Dr Purohit explains. “If the skin damage is minor, such as a small cut or burn, the healed skin may be just as soft as the surrounding undamaged skin. However, if the skin damage is more extensive, such as a large burn or deep wound, the healed skin may not be as soft as the surrounding undamaged skin.”
Dr Purohit goes on to explain that in some cases, the healed skin may be slightly harder or thicker than the surrounding undamaged skin. This is because the healing process often involves the formation of scar tissue, which can be slightly harder and thicker than the surrounding skin.
“In some cases, the scar tissue can be softened with treatments such as laser resurfacing or dermabrasion,” Dr Purohit adds. “These treatments can help to restore the skin’s softness and texture.”
So, while it is possible to achieve the same softness in healed skin as with normal undamaged skin, it depends on the type of skin damage and the treatment used to heal it. With the right treatment, however, it is possible to restore the skin’s softness and texture.
